Kawalangbisa (en. Nullity)
/ka-walang-bi-sa/
Meaning & Definition
EnglishTagalog
noun
The condition or state of being null or ineffective.
Due to the nullity of the contract, it cannot be enforced.
Dahil sa kawalangbisa ng kontrata, hindi ito mapapatupad.
The nullity of a legal document or agreement.
The nullity of the document caused many problems.
Ang kawalangbisa ng dokumento ay nagdulot ng maraming problema.
The lack of effect or impact of an action or decision.
The decision nullified the set plans.
Ang desisyon ay nagdulot ng kawalangbisa sa mga planong itinakda.
